1. Loan Options and Strategies to Manage Student Debt

Federal Student Loan Programs

The primary source of student funding in the United States is federal student loans, which typically offer favorable interest rates and flexible repayment plans. For students attending Las Positas College, federal options include:

  • Direct Subsidized Loans: Available to undergraduate students with demonstrated financial need. The government pays the interest while you're in school at least half-time.
  • Direct Unsubsidized Loans: Available to all undergraduate students regardless of financial need, with interest accruing during school years.

Given the relatively low tuition costs at Las Positas College, many students may rely primarily on federal loans to cover their expenses. It's essential to borrow only what is necessary to minimize debt burden post-graduation.

Private Student Loan Options

Private lenders offer student loans that might supplement federal aid but often come with higher interest rates and less flexible repayment terms. They may be necessary for students with additional financial needs or for those seeking to cover costs beyond federal loan limits. Always compare lender terms and consider the long-term implications before opting for private loans.

Loan Management Strategies

Effective debt management begins with careful planning:

  • Borrow Responsibly: Borrow only what is needed for tuition, fees, and essential supplies.
  • Understand Repayment Plans: Familiarize yourself with options such as Income-Driven Repayment (IDR), Standard, Graduated, and Extended repayment plans.
  • Consider Loan Forgiveness Programs: For some careers, such as public service, loan forgiveness options might be available after a set period of qualifying payments.
  • Budget Wisely: Develop a personal budget that accounts for loan repayment to prevent financial strain post-graduation.

2. Program Overview and What Students Will Study

Curriculum Focus and Learning Outcomes

The Computer Programming program at Las Positas College provides foundational knowledge in programming languages, software development, and problem-solving skills essential for the tech industry. Students will learn:

  • Core programming languages such as Python, Java, and C++
  • Software development principles and methodologies
  • Data structures, algorithms, and computational logic
  • Database management and SQL
  • Web development fundamentals including HTML, CSS, and JavaScript
  • Introduction to mobile app development and user interface design

The coursework emphasizes practical skills, project-based learning, and collaboration, preparing students for entry-level programming roles.

Hands-On Experience and Certifications

Students will have opportunities to participate in internships, capstone projects, and industry partnerships. Additionally, earning certifications such as Microsoft Certified: Azure Developer Associate or CompTIA certifications can enhance employability upon graduation.

3. Career Opportunities and Job Prospects

Potential Career Paths

A degree in Computer Programming opens the door to numerous roles within the tech industry, including:

  • Software Developer
  • Web Developer
  • Mobile Application Developer
  • Database Administrator
  • Quality Assurance Tester
  • Systems Analyst
  • Technical Support Specialist

Many roles are in high demand across various sectors, including finance, healthcare, entertainment, and government agencies.

Job Market Outlook

The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ics projects strong growth in computer and information technology occupations, with a median annual wage that often exceeds the national average. Entry-level salaries for programming roles typically start around $50,000 to $70,000, with potential to increase as experience and specialization grow.

4. Admission Considerations

Eligibility and Prerequisites

Prospective students should have a high school diploma or equivalent. While specific prerequisites for the programming program are minimal, a basic understanding of mathematics and logical thinking is advantageous.

Application Process

Applicants should complete the Las Positas College admissions process, including submitting transcripts, completing the application form, and possibly attending orientation sessions. For financial aid consideration, students must fill out the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) annually.

Important Admission Tips

  • Apply early to secure financial aid and class registration.
  • Seek academic advising to plan your coursework effectively.
  • Explore scholarship opportunities offered through the college or external organizations.
